London, A. J. Newman and Co. C1826. Leather. 'William and his Uncle Ben A Tale Designed for the Use of Young People' by Mrs. Hofland. With half title, illustrated second title and engraved frontispiece but with title absent. Barbara Hofland (1770 - 1844) was an English writer of some sixty-six didactic, moral stories for children, and of schoolbooks and poetry. Previous owner's ink inscription to front pastedown. In a quarter crushed morocco binding with marbled paper boards. Externally, sound but with some wear to extremities, rubbing and marks to boards and some loss to paper to boards. Front free endpaper and title absent. Joints strained. Internally, firmly bound. Bright and generally clean but with slight scattered foxing, handling marks and odd small ink stains. Good Only .
